The garage occupancy feed for the Brindlewood campus arrives over a message queue every thirty seconds, one record per level, published by the Stallgrid edge boxes. Counts can briefly go negative when a sensor double-fires on exit; the ingest job clamps these to zero and flags the interval. If the feed stalls for more than five minutes, the dashboard falls back to the last known snapshot. Sensor mappings, queue names, and the replay procedure are documented on the internal page below.

runbook for tahog-kadug: https://gitlab.qirvanworks.corp/projects/pages/view/b139298aed28

### Ticket: Session-token refresh drift — Gatelatch auth service

New folks: read this before debugging token complaints. Production and canary have drifted. Canary refreshes session tokens every 15 minutes; production still uses the old 60-minute window. Result: users bounced between pools get logged out mid-session. Root cause is a manual hotfix applied to canary in June that never landed in the config repo. Fix is to reconcile both environments. Current production values for reference follow.

settings of fawip-yadug:
[druath]
port = 3000
region = north-4
host = druath.qirvanworks.corp
timeout_ms = 1500
retries = 1

## Reviewing the Fernwhistle N+1 fix

The order-history resolver in Fernwhistle previously issued one database query per line item, which ballooned to thousands of queries on large accounts. The fix batches lookups through a per-request dataloader keyed on item ID. When reviewing related changes, confirm that any new resolver either uses the loader or documents why it can't. Benchmarks live in the perf folder. To run the benchmark suite against the sealed staging snapshot, unlock it with the recovery passphrase below.

unlock words, yawig-kagef: gordor-holvan-ulaael-pramir-ulaiel-tamdor